Description

"Bishop Kofi, we have come for your head." Ed Kofi hid beneath a wooden bench on the cement floor of the church he founded. He prayed the rebels would not find him as they searched and taunted him, banging their machetes against the pine pews. A compelling story from start to finish-harrowing and heroic. Read of this present-day Paul, the churches he planted and the perils he endured during the years of the Liberian civil war. Brown paints scenes of heart-stopping moments... narrowly escaping execution by border-crossing militia, rebels on the move toward his orphanage, and the faithful resolve of a man and his fellow church members who trust in their God.
